Re: [問題] 想要自動產生變數

看板Python作者 (閉關自守)時間17年前 (2008/04/25 00:28), 編輯推噓1(101)
留言2則, 2人參與, 最新討論串4/5 (看更多)
※ 引述《qrtt1 (null)》之銘言: : ※ 引述《hiton (閉關自守)》之銘言: : : 我是初探python的菜鳥>\\\< : : 有爬過文 但是沒找到靈感 : : 所以想請問一下各位前輩 : : 如果我想要寫個程式碼依據資料量自己產生變數組 : : 例如 a1,a2,a3....a100等等 : : 該怎麼下手比較好? : : 有沒有什麼建議可以給我? : : 還有就是序列(list)中的資料如果又是序列(list) 有辦法一次把某個元素提出來嘛? : : 例如 tmp={1:[1,2,3,4],2:[5,6,7,8],3:[9,0,1,2]} : : 我目前只想到設一個變數去提序列中的某個元素 : : 像是 a=tmp[1] : : print a[1] : : 小弟愚昧 : : 懇請各位前輩賜教 謝謝... : 雖然知道你想要自動產生變數 : 這也能透過 meta-programming 的方式做到 : 但是您也可以說說您打算怎麼使用這些變數 : 它會有什麼內容,你打算怎麼使用它 : 也許版友討論後,可能就沒有產生變數的需要了 謝謝前輩你的建議 我是打算從一筆龐大的序列數值中把各個序列提出來 然後再來畫3D的平面圖 有點類似台灣地圖各個點某個數值的3D分量圖 現在是已經有序列了 而我會想到要自動產生變數的原因 大部分是因為我提不出來序列中序列的某個值 才想到設自動產生變數這個東西 而之後也可能可以用這些產生出來的來分析這些數據 像是曲線,梯度等等 不過已經有另一個版友跟我講了怎麼提出來 我想目前可能是先不用自動產生變數了 謝謝前輩你的指教...>\\\< -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.64.119.37

04/25 01:59, , 1F
請愛用 numpy, scipy, matplotlib
04/25 01:59, 1F

04/25 13:04, , 2F
知道...謝謝~
04/25 13:04, 2F
文章代碼(AID): #184BKTLS (Python)
文章代碼(AID): #184BKTLS (Python)